Возможно и намудрил, но почему тогда у других работает?
|
У других то же самое, просто проявляется по разному и менее заметно на производительных машинах.
При запуске на слабой машине, или запуске парралельно с ресурсоёмкими приложениями ака ЗДМах в процессе рендеринга, ФПС резко падает, в то время как скорость логики остаётся на прежнем уровне. В итоге- рывки и/или полное пропадание изображения без потерь скорости логики.
Это явные и довольно распространенные глюки синхронизации, которая у тебя непонятно зачем пытается сохранить скорость логики, вырубая рендер, а ты ей не мешаешь исполнять эти чёрные замыслы.

У Меркулова в журнале эти вопросы обсуждались.
По поводу Memory access...., у меня тоже такая радость появлялась, когда я запускал чужие проекты на Blitz3D. Кто знает, что это за глюк и как с ним бороться???
|
Какая у тебя версия Блица? Старые имеют неполную совместимость с современным железом.
Если Блиц новый- проверь, не используешь ли ты нестабильные фичи Блица: террайны, РидПикселФасты, и пр. Это тоже обсуждалось.
***
В плане геймплея- он слишком однообразен, но по сути мало отличается от геймплея любого скроллера. Ресурсы по красивей, больше разнообразия в действиях врагов, некоторое разнообразие в тактике игрока- и продать такую игру будет вполне возможно.
Как доп. фича- можно сделать атаки противника с разных сторон, снабдить базу несколькими поворачивающимися управляемыми орудиями с разными ТТХ и разным расположением, между которыми нужно переключаться для перекрытия огнём каждой точки периметра, стены/щит и систему аварийного оповещения о прорывах... Т.е. лучше отойти от идеи скроллера.
Удачи!